Player of the Week: Baser Amer continues clutch heroics for Meralco

By: - Reporter / @MarkGiongcoINQ
/ 05:31 PM November 13, 2018

Allen Durham has been a given and others have stepped up during Meralco’s hot streak but no local has played a bigger role in the Bolts’ last three games than Baser Amer.

Down the stretch has been “Hammer Time” with Amer no stranger to thriving in the endgame.

The heady point guard was clutch again in lifting Meralco over No. 2 Phoenix, 108-103, in overtime in a knockout duel on Friday, burying back-to-back triples in overtime that put the Fuel Masters away and propelled the seventh-seeded Bolts into the semifinals.

The 26-year-old Amer finished with 26 points two nights after having an all-around game of 14 points, four rebounds and six assists in a 90-74 rout of Phoenix that forced the rubber match.

The former San Beda star sustained his form in the semifinals after putting up 14 points, four rebounds, three assists and one steal to help Meralco beat No. 3 Alaska, 97-92, in Game 1 of a best-of-five on Sunday in Antipolo.

Amer, who earned the Cignal-PBA Press Corps Player of the Week citation, averaged 18 points, 4.2 rebounds, 4.2 assists and 1.6 steals the past week.

He edged teammate Chris Newsome, Magnolia’s Paul Lee, Barangay Ginebra’s Japeth Aguilar and Alaska’s Vic Manuel for the weekly award.
